Legacy technologies are platforms and tools that have been discontinued or shut down and no longer operate. Some are completely defunct, while others remain functional but unsupported.

Jordan is a Western Asian country with a population of over 11 million people.

The following list shows the legacy technologies ranked from 26th to 36th out of 36 used on websites in Jordan.
